1. Highland Cow Experience at Scarlet Springs Farm (Waterford, VA)

Dates:

  • Saturday, November 15Harvest Under the Stars Dinner

  • Sunday, November 16 – Daytime Highland Cow Sessions

Official Website: scarletspringsfarm.com/specialevents

Waterford’s Scarlet Springs Farm delivers one of the most charming fall experiences in Northern Virginia — hands-on Highland cow interactions paired with warm cider and fresh donut bites. On Saturday, the “Harvest Under the Stars” event adds a chef-prepared, farm-to-table dinner enjoyed under heaters and string lights.

Quick Details:

  • Price: ~$149 for dinner

  • Location: Waterford, VA

  • Great For: Couples, families, fall weekend getaways

Tip: Dress warmly — temperatures drop quickly on the farm, even with heaters.


2. DMV Chocolate & Coffee Festival (Chantilly, VA)

Dates:

  • Saturday, November 15 – 10am–5pm (VIP: 9–10am)

  • Sunday, November 16 – 10am–4pm

Official Website: dmvchocolateandcoffee.com

One of the region’s largest indoor food festivals returns to the Dulles Expo Center with 200+ chocolate makers, coffee roasters, and artisan vendors. Expect tastings, demos, holiday shopping, and caffeinated energy all weekend long.

Quick Details:

  • Price: ~$18 GA | ~$36 VIP

  • Location: Dulles Expo Center, Chantilly

  • Great For: Food lovers, families, early shoppers

Tip: VIP early access is worth it if you want to try the most popular vendors without long lines.


3. Catoctin Holiday Art Studio Tour (Western Loudoun County)

Dates:

  • Saturday, November 15 – 10am–5pm

  • Sunday, November 16 – 10am–5pm

Official Website: catoctinart.com

Cruise through Western Loudoun’s scenic countryside while visiting local artists working inside their studios and barns. From pottery and jewelry to glasswork and woodcraft, this self-guided tour is one of NoVA’s most authentic creative experiences.

Quick Details:

  • Price: Free

  • Location: Lovettsville / Catoctin region

  • Great For: Art lovers, couples, slow weekend explorers

Tip: Start early and plan your route — some studios sit on narrow rural backroads.


4. A Monster Calls – Live Stage Play (Reston, VA)

Dates:

  • Friday, November 14 – 7:30pm

  • Saturday, November 15 – 2pm & 7:30pm

Official Website: slakestheatre.com

This is the first time A Monster Calls has been staged in Northern Virginia — and it’s a standout. Expect a cinematic, emotionally charged production with strong performances, atmospheric lighting, and a resonant storyline.

Quick Details:

  • Price: ~$12 adults | ~$8 students

  • Location: South Lakes High School, Reston

  • Great For: Date night, teens, theater lovers

Tip: This show includes haze and strobe effects — plan accordingly.


5. American Patchwork Quartet – Reston Community Center

Date:

  • Sunday, November 16 – 3pm

Official Website: restoncommunitycenter.com/event/american-patchwork-quartet

A world-fusion folk ensemble featuring GRAMMY-connected musicians performs an intimate Sunday afternoon show. Expect a blend of jazz, African rhythms, and Americana in one of NoVA’s best listening-room-style venues.

Quick Details:

  • Price: ~$35–$40

  • Location: Reston Community Center – CenterStage

  • Great For: Music lovers, cultural outings, Sunday date ideas

Tip: Arrive early — seating is limited and the venue fills quickly.


6. Fairfax Holiday Craft Show (Fairfax, VA)

Dates:

  • Saturday, November 15 – 10am–5pm

  • Sunday, November 16 – 10am–3pm

Official Website: Hosted via City of Fairfax Parks & Recreation

This beloved annual craft show brings more than 200 artisan vendors to Fairfax High School for one of the region’s biggest indoor holiday markets. You’ll find handmade décor, gourmet treats, seasonal gifts, woodworking, textiles, and more.

Quick Details:

  • Price: ~$5 one-day | ~$8 weekend

  • Location: Fairfax High School

  • Great For: Families, early holiday shoppers, indoor plans

Tip: Saturday morning offers the best selection before crowds arrive.
